How To Add Users

Manage your Clearooms users by sending invitations or bulk importing accounts.

Settings > Account > UsersThis page shows you all your users and the invitations that have been sent out. 

Users can be invited from this page or bulk imported from here. For adding users via Single Sign On, see details on the Apps and Integrations > SSO Page.
 

Inviting Users to your Account

To invite a new user, click on "Invite User",  enter their email address and select a suitable role for them. They will receive an email with a link to a registration page that's linked to your account.

This invitation is a one-off link; once the user has registered, the link will not work. The user must log in from https://portal.clearooms.com/login.

If you have invited anyone to your account and they have not yet registered, these invitations will show at the top of the list. 

Invitations that have been used won't be in this list; they will show below in the "Users" list.

If an invitation does not get used within 7 days, it will expire. You can resend the invitation by clicking on the refresh icon next to an invitation.

Bulk Import - Creating your CSV

Bulk Import bypasses the invitation process and sets Users up directly in the system, ready to log in. The bulk import template (you can download it from the bulk import page) has the following fields: 

  • Full Name: Mandatory
  • Email: Mandatory 
    • This must be a valid email address
  • Role: Optional
    • Must be one of "User", "Super User", "Manager", "Admin". If omitted, it will default to "User"
  • Office: Optional
    • The user's default office will show. Name must match to an existing office. If omitted, the user's default office will be the default office for the organisation
  • Team: Optional
    • The team the user belongs to. Name must match to an existing team. If omitted, the user will not belong to a team
  • Password: Optional
    •  If a password is omitted, a password will be generated and can be downloaded once the import is finished

Bulk Import - Uploading your CSV

When your CSV is ready, upload it, and the system will check it and advise if there are any issues. If there are issues, the CSV will need to be corrected and re-uploaded. Don't worry, any errors spotted will be clearly explained and the row numbers provided. 

Once you successfully import your users, you can provide access for them by several options: 

  1. Send them the login page along with the password you set on the import (or the generated password) https://portal.clearooms.com/login  
  2. Send them the forgotten password link: https://portal.clearooms.com/forgot-password and ask them to reset their password from this page.
  3. If you have Single Sign On set up, send them the unique URL listed on the SSO set-up page.

Self-Registration Links

As an alternative to manually inviting or importing users, Clearooms also allows you to create self-registration links. These links let users securely sign up and gain access to your Clearooms account without requiring an admin to send invitations or upload a CSV file.

When to Use Self-Registration Links

Self-registration is ideal for:

  • Large teams or departments where users can join independently

  • Temporary or project-based access (using expiry dates)

  • Visitor or contractor registration via QR codes displayed in reception areas

How It Works

Administrators can create and manage self-registration links from Settings > Users. Each link can include:

  • A default user role assignment

  • Optional team allocation

  • An optional expiry date to control access duration

  • An automatically generated QR code for easy sharing

You can also edit existing links, update expiry dates, or download and share QR codes directly from the Users page.
